How much does it cost to rent a home in Cambridge?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cambridge 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,672 | $1,325 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,418 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,186 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,033 | $800 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,243 | $875 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,781 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|

What type of rentals are currently available in Cambridge?
There are currently 21357 Apartments for Rent in Cambridge, MA with pricing that ranges from $375 to $45,000. There are also 14445 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cambridge ranging from $500 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cambridge?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cambridge ranges from $500 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,547.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Cambridge?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Cambridge range from $1,100 to $45,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,050 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$850 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
